Fly on Over to See Ariana Grande and Cynthia Erivo's Wicked Reunion at the Olympics

Ariana Grande and Cynthia Erivo aren’t in Oz anymore.
The Wicked costars arrived at the Opening Ceremony for the 2024 Olympics in Paris on July 26. And fans may feel like they've been changed for good once they see their chic outfits.
Ariana rocked a pink dress with a pleated skirt and bow detailing on the red carpet—finishing off a look Glinda surely would love with a hair ribbon and gloves. Meanwhile, Cynthia dazzled in a green dress and matching hat that were so good they could have made Elphaba even more green with envy.
Still, they insisted they didn’t plan to coordinate.
“We did not. We never do this, and it always happens” Ariana joked to NBC, with Cynthia adding, it just “happens by accident.”
And as the Olympians display brains, heart and courage throughout the Games, the Grammy winners are excited to cheer them on.
“This is probably the first Olympics I’ve ever been able to attend in-person,” Cynthia continued. “It’s been a bit of a dream to do this and to do it in Paris is really special, too.”
In terms of the event that’s most popular in their eyes?
“We’re so excited for the women’s gymnastics,” Ariana shared, adding they’re looking forward to Simone Biles’ routine. “We were, like, counting down.”
In addition, Cynthia said she couldn’t wait to root on Sha'Carri Richardson in track and field. And now that the Olympics are underway, they won’t have to hold out for too much longer to see which athletes take home a medal.
But for fans counting down until Wicked’s release, well they’ll have to be a bit more patient. The first chapter premieres Nov. 22 while the second won’t be released until 2025.
Still, the singers dropped some hints about what moviegoers can expect.
“I think they have a lot to look forward to,” Ariana told the outlet. “I think they’re definitely going to laugh and cry and have their hearts really moved.”
Agreed Cynthia, “I think it’s one of those pieces it’s surprisingly moving. Well, not surprising to us, but I think people will be pleasantly surprised by how much they can connect with it and how moving it can be and how much they connect with these two women and the other characters who are existing in that beautiful world.”
